CONGRATULATING SHAWN GRAVES OF WOFFORD COLLEGE UPON BEING NAMED SOUTH CAROLINA AMATEUR ATHLETE OF THE YEAR.
Whereas, Shawn Graves of Wofford College has been named the South Carolina Amateur Athlete of the Year; and
Whereas, Shawn owns four National Collegiate Athletic Association (NCAA) records: yards rushing in a season by a quarterback (1,483); touchdowns by a freshman (24); touchdowns in a season by a quarterback (24); and rushing average per game by a quarterback (147.1); and
Whereas, he is a prime contender for the Harlon Hill Trophy, the Division II equivalent of the Heisman; and
Whereas, he led Wofford to a 9-3 record in 1990 and the school's first-ever NCAA playoff appearance; and
Whereas, he owns sixteen school records as a football player for the Terriers; and
Whereas, he was the South Carolina High School Player of the Year for all classifications in 1988; and
Whereas, as a member of the Wofford Players Speakers Bureau, he routinely visits local schools to lecture on the value of education and staying away from drugs; and
Whereas, he is clearly a gifted athlete whose accomplishments and superb talent have contributed greatly to Wofford's football success; and
Whereas, he is also an outstanding young man with a well-developed sense of responsibility for his fellow human beings; and
Whereas, his success and his honors are highly deserving of recognition. Now, therefore,
Be it resolved by the House of Representatives, the Senate concurring:
That the General Assembly of the State of South Carolina, by this resolution, congratulates Shawn Graves of Wofford College upon being named South Carolina Amateur Athlete of the Year.
